These fasteners are indispensable across the maritime industrial spectrum. In naval defense and shipbuilding, they are used to assemble hulls, secure armor plating, and fasten critical systems in warships, submarines, and support vessels. The commercial shipping industry utilizes them in engine rooms, for securing cargo holds, and in the construction of superstructures. Offshore energy sectors rely on them for constructing and maintaining drilling platforms, floating production units, and subsea infrastructure. Additionally, they are vital for port and harbor construction, coastal defense projects, and marine research vessels, where exposure to harsh elements is constant and reliability cannot be compromised.
